Basic Rules and Objective
Blackjack, often known as 21, is a staple fiber of casino gaming both online and in land-based venues across the UK. The primary objective is straightforward: attain a deal value higher than the dealer’s without olympian 21. Cards are valued as follows: numbered cards retain their face value, face cards (Jack, Queen mole rat, King) are worth 10, and an A-one can be counted as either 1 or 11, depending on which benefits the hand more. From each one customer receives two cards initially, as does the dealer, though one of the dealer’s cards is typically face up. Players then have several options: hit (take another card), stand (keep their current hand), double down (double the original gamble and receive exactly one more card), split (if the first two cards are of equal value, separate them into two hands and play each independently), or surrender (throw overboard half the bet and end the hand). The dealer must follow a fixed set of rules: they must hit on a hand total of 16 or less and stand on 17 or more, including a soft 17 (a hand containing an Ace counted as 11 that totals 17). Savvy these fundamentals is crucial before delving deeper into strategy or variant nuances.
Popular Blackjack Variants in the UK
While the classic version of blackjack is widely available, UK players will encounter several popular variants that introduce twists to the standard rules. European Blackjack is a unwashed variation where the dealer receives only unity card face up initially and does not invite a second card until after players have acted. Additionally, players cannot surrender, and the dealer typically stands on soft 17. Another favourite is Blackjack Switch, where players are dealt two hands and may swap the top two cards between them, offering sir thomas more strategic flexibility but often at the cost of a higher put up edge due to the dealer’s push on 22. Pontoon, a British variant, uses different terminology: the purpose is to achieve a ‘pontoon’ (an Tiptop and a 10-value card) which pays amend than a regular blackjack, and the dealer’s cards are both dealt face push down. Spanish 21 removes all 10s from the deck, increasing the put up edge, but compensates with bonus payouts for certain hands like 6-7-8 or 7-7-7. For those seeking a faster pace, Speed Blackjack and Infinite Blackjack are online adaptations that enable multiple players to conjoin a single dealer hand, with rounds completing quickly. Each variant adjusts the put up border and strategy slightly, so players should familiarise themselves with the specific rules before playing.
RTP, House Edge, and Basic Strategy
Return to Player (RTP) and domiciliate border are fundamental concepts that directly impact a player’s long-term outcomes. In blackjack, the RTP can vary significantly based on the ruleset. A criterion game with favourable rules—such as a single deck, dealer standing on soft 17, and blackjack paying 3:2—can offer an RTP of around 99.5% when using perfect canonic strategy, translating to a house edge of merely 0.5%. However, rule variations like a 6:5 blackjack payout, the dealer hitting on soft 17, or allowing give up only after the dealer checks for blackjack can force the put up edge higher, sometimes above 1%. Basic strategy is a mathematically derived countersink of decisions that minimises the house sharpness. It dictates when to hit, remain firm, stunt man, split, or deliver based on the player’s paw total and the dealer’s upcard. For instance, a player should always split Aces and 8s, never split up 10s or 5s, and double cut down on 11 against a dealer’s 2-10. Many UK online casinos present free blackjack games or strategy charts to help players learn. Employing basic strategy consistently is the most effective way to decrease the house edge and maximise potential returns over time. It is important to note that while basic strategy optimises play, it does not guarantee wins in the short term due to the inherent variance of the game.
